If you're a resident of the beautiful Sunshine State, maybe the
last thing on your mind is your dental care, but sooner or later,
you'll have to take a serious look at your teeth and find out what
you can do with them. Finding dental insurance in Florida is relatively
straightforward, but as with most things, the more you know, the
better a position you will be in.
Whenever you're looking for insurance of any type in Florida, you'll
want to head to the webpage of the Florida Department of Financial
Services. This is a great place to figure out what's going on and
what might be offered that will pertain to you. This is also a
good place to check up on any companies that you are investigating;
this site will direct you to a list of complaints that have been
filed and you will be able to see what other people have said about
your prospective provider.
If you are searching online, you have many sites at your disposal
and if you search for Florida dental plans, you will be most likely
be inundated with options. Keep in mind that if it sounds too good
to be true, it most likely is; be careful about signing up for
anything sight-unseen. Places that have references are best, so
if you find a policy you like, search for the company it came from.
Good or bad, a lot of people write up their experiences online
and that's usually a good indicator of what kind of policy you're
getting into. While searching online might be easiest, don't forget
to check your local yellow pages, and remember that the best reference
regarding dental insurance is the one that comes from a mouth full
of healthy teeth. Check out the smiles you see and ask where they
go to insure them.
Insurance rates in Florida are usually highly competitive and
this can definitely work in your favor. Keep notes and price track,
and if you are meeting with representatives, don't be afraid to
ask why their policy might be pricier than their competition's.
The answers might surprise you, and you can get the best deal available
this way.
Don't forget to figure out exactly what you need. While a policy
with a lot of coverage might be more comforting, try to figure
out how much its worth in the long run. When looking for an affordable
policy, these are things you need to keep in mind. If you have
a history of dental problems and the sneaking suspicion that they're
not over, you might as well pay for a high premium and a low deductible;
you'll probably end up spending the money anyway, and at least
in this case, you can control how you spend and when.
